Output 631785736af3d28693424306c003875f12b4e7c37967e07b599bdad6433d3cc3:58

value
175801
script pubkey
OP_0 OP_PUSHBYTES_20 8f5ed91426e00aa1dc732bad78814881069461c3
address
bc1q3a0dj9pxuq92rhrn9wkh3q2gsyrfgcwr0vhqw6
transaction
631785736af3d28693424306c003875f12b4e7c37967e07b599bdad6433d3cc3